League of Nations Pamphlet, December 1937

 File — Box: AR00049, Folder: 5
Scope and Contents

This folder contains Volume 1, Issue 2 of the China Reference series, titled League of Nations Reports, which was initially published on December 8, 1937, by the Trans-Pacific News Service. This is the third printing from February 28, 1938. This pamphlet covers the first and second reports of the subcommittee of the Far East Advisory Committee on October 5, 1937, as well as a report from the Far East Advisory Committee presented to the general assembly.

Dates: December 1937

Military Passes and List of Sympathy Cards, July 1943 - October 1943

 File — Box: AR00049, Folder: 7
Scope and Contents

This folder contains a list of names and addresses for creating sympathy cards, a photocopy of the same sympathy card list of names, two U.S.N.P.D.C. mess hall passes, and two Navy Personnel Center general detail liberty passes awarded to First Class Fire Controlman Earl M. Stiefel.

Dates: July 1943 - October 1943

Magazines and Excerpts , September 1943 - September 1945

 File — Box: AR00049, Folder: 8
Scope and Contents

This folder contains articles from Our Navy, National Geographic, and All Hands. The articles featured within this folder have been removed from these magazines. Most of these articles center around the United States’ advancement to Japan, photographs of sailors operating their battle stations, the Navy fighting throughout the Asiatic-Pacific Theater, and a special look at naval vessels.

Dates: September 1943 - September 1945

Military Service Documents and Magazine Pages, July 1943

 File — Box: AR00049, Folder: 10
Scope and Contents

This folder contains a letter from the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ania written on a half-sheet awarding a check for the recipients military service, a letter from the U.S. Naval Personnel Separation Center addressed to Earl Malcolm Stiefel, Earl Malcolm Stiefel’s selective service card to report for physical examination in New Castle, Pennsylvania, an envelope from the USS West Virginia, and two magazine articles from an unknown publication.

Dates: July 1943
